Still not sure why the feed worked. They were pretty clear about blocking it inside the US. Seems they can't get that right either.
From their FB page "the IMSA.tv stream is only available for the full race outside of the U.S. FOX Sports GO is the exclusive live stream provider. FS1 Authentication gets the whole race."
And the commercials in the last 20 minutes were just egregious.
I paid the subscription to watch WEC online and I hesitate to say that might be the way to go here. As long as it's reasonable. And the app works. Like $20. Airplay from my ipad to the appletv to watch on the big screen actually worked really well except for the crashing. And the radiolemans commentary is much much better. I like our crew but the little factoids and the information the RLM guys give you about everything that's happening on track is head and shoulders above the regular broadcast crew. They mostly only talk about what's on screen and rarely update you on the other classes. RLM seems to do a ton of research on every car, team and driver and it shows.
